If an object is neutrally buoyant in fresh water, the same object placed into salt water would... CORRECT ANSWER Float I blow up a balloon, tie it off, and take it to the bottom of the swimming pool. What will happen to the balloon and the air inside it? CORRECT ANSWER The balloon will get smaller and the air inside the balloon will be more dense I turn a glass upside down, trap the air in it by putting it in water, and then I take the glass down to 10 m/33 ft. The air space would... CORRECT ANSWER Become half the size it was at the surface If I am not able to equalize my body air spaces, it may be because I have... CORRECT ANSWER A cold, allergy or another medical problem If my ears or sinuses hurt while I am descending, it usually means... CORRECT ANSWER I am feeling a squeeze and need to equalize The best place for me to position an alternate air source is... CORRECT ANSWER In the triangle area formed by my chin and the lower corners of my rib cage Lung overexpansion injuries can be caused by... CORRECT ANSWER Holding my breath while scuba diving If my cylinder of air lasts 60 minutes while I am at the surface breathing normally, assuming all else is the same, how long will it last at 20 m/66 ft. breathing normally? CORRECT ANSWER 20 minutes
